网络黑客可能会学习使用各种软件,如Kali Linux(一个基于Debian的Linux发行版,用于数字取证和渗透测试)、Nmap(网络扫描工具)、Metasploit(用于渗透测试的框架)等。这些软件可以帮助他们分析和利用网络安全漏洞。
网络黑客学习所需软件下载
1、操作系统
Windows: 适用于大多数黑客工具和程序,但易受攻击。
Linux: 更安全、稳定,适合初学者和专业黑客。
Mac OS: 安全性较高,但兼容性较差。
2、编程工具
Visual Studio Code: 免费、开源的代码编辑器,支持多种编程语言。
PyCharm: 针对Python语言的集成开发环境,提供代码补全、调试等功能。
Eclipse: 适用于Java、C/C++等多种编程语言的集成开发环境。
3、网络安全工具
Nmap: 网络扫描工具,用于发现网络上的主机和服务。
Metasploit: 渗透测试框架,提供漏洞利用、监听等功能。
Wireshark: 网络协议分析工具,用于捕获和分析网络数据包。
4、Web安全工具
Burp Suite: 用于Web应用程序安全测试的集成平台。
SQLMap: 自动化SQL注入和数据库提取工具。
OWASP ZAP: 开源Web应用程序安全扫描器。
5、密码破解工具
John the Ripper: 用于破解各种类型密码的开源工具。
Hydra: 支持多种协议的在线密码破解工具。
Aircrackng: 用于破解无线网络密码的工具。
6、逆向工程工具
IDA Pro: 反汇编、调试和分析二进制文件的专业工具。
Ghidra: 美国国家安全局开发的逆向工程框架。
OllyDbg: 动态调试器,用于分析恶意软件和其他二进制文件。
7、社会工程工具
SET (SocialEngineer Toolkit): 用于创建钓鱼攻击和其他社会工程攻击的工具集。
Reconng: 用于信息收集和社会工程的框架。
Koadic: 自动收集目标信息的Python工具。
8、无线网络工具
Aircrackng: 用于破解无线网络密码的工具。
Kismet: 无线网络嗅探器和入侵检测系统。
WiFi Jammer: 用于干扰无线网络连接的工具。
请注意,使用这些工具进行非法活动是违法的,本文档仅供学习和研究目的。